The take out is Modrow bridge. Like Fish Hog mentioned there is a spot just above Fallert Creek bridge that will try and push you into the rock wall on the left side. There is also a big rock in the first rapid just below Pritchards but it is easy to avoid. The spot behind Mahaffeys will try and push you into the wall at times also but it is pretty easy also.
